Chargement des acteurs...
The Furious Gods: Making Prometheus
Self
2012
From Nothing, Something: A Documentary on the Creative Process
Visualizing TRON
2011
Love & Game
Jellyfish Documentary Narrator (voice)
2010
Star Trek
Romulan Crew Member
2009